The still hour / La hora inmóvil
by Bernard Plossu
Photographs: Bernard Plossu
Publisher: La Fabrica
144 pages
Pictures: 106
Year: 2016
ISBN: 978–84–16248–53–7
Price: 46.20 €
Comments: Hardcover, 23x28 cm
Mediterranean metaphysics is the subtitle of this project by the French artist Bernard Plossu. It gathers 150 images taken over the course of 30 years in the south of France, Spain, Greece, Italy and Turkey. In these snapshots, the omnipresent white light eclipses people in a visual exercise that reflects on the real dimension of the landscapes and architectures. The images shape a timeless space in an almost dream–like journey through time and light.
